The CS case number and notification rate of Guangdong Province, 2005–2020
| Year | Number of live births | Number of confirmed cases | Notification rate, 1/100,000 live births |
|---|---|---|---|
| 2005 | 826,754 | 601 | 72.69 |
| 2006 | 856,062 | 953 | 111.32 |
| 2007 | 933,180 | 1,152 | 123.45 |
| 2008 | 1076,485 | 1,182 | 109.80 |
| 2009 | 1,104,865 | 1,203 | 108.88 |
| 2010 | 1,160,645 | 1,301 | 112.09 |
| 2011 | 1,209,687 | 1,555 | 128.55 |
| 2012 | 1,365,005 | 1,471 | 107.76 |
| 2013 | 1,335,902 | 1,056 | 79.05 |
| 2014 | 1,279,995 | 834 | 65.16 |
| 2015 | 1,285,983 | 535 | 41.60 |
| 2016 | 1,328,820 | 322 | 24.23 |
| 2017 | 1,528,465 | 204 | 13.35 |
| 2018 | 1,317,907 | 140 | 10.62 |
| 2019 | 1,292,526 | 96 | 7.43 |
| 2020 | 1,406,854 | 81 | 5.76 |
Notification rate = number of confirmed cases/numbers of live births*10,000

Fig. 4Interrupted time series plot of annual change of congenital syphilis notification rate in Guangdong Province and the three regions before and after the implementation of the CS control measures. The intervention year was 2012. The slope and level change of the province were both significant, P < 0.05 (a). The level change in the PRD region (b) and North ecological development zone (d) were both significant, P < 0.05; the slope change in the North ecological development zone (Fig. 4d) and Eastern and Western wings (c) were both significant, P < 0.05
